Output 54391c6c84d83bcc34b8cf6a8418ea63763be7c76be6312c967ec643a3faa8be:8

value
156612010
script pubkey
OP_0 OP_PUSHBYTES_20 c04a9437d3f2f1f633b3377eb19e68764a20b396
address
bc1qcp9fgd7n7tclvvanxaltr8ngwe9zpvukdr29j8
transaction
54391c6c84d83bcc34b8cf6a8418ea63763be7c76be6312c967ec643a3faa8be
confirmations
98177
spent
true